Bristol Refugee Rights English classes

Free, informal, volunteer-taught English (ESOL) courses for beginners. Asylum seekers and new refugees who are Bristol Refugee Rights members can join the courses. Membership is free. We specialise in classes for beginners, including basic literacy.
